September 15, 2010
A barge owned by Bowhead Transport ran aground between Oooguruk Island and Olikok Point along Alaska’s artic shoreline. The barge suffered some damage with the stern wheelhouse broke loose and settled stern first.

A barge sank on the Nile river near the city of Aswan. The vessel released 100 tons of diesel fuel. The barge was carrying 240 tons of diesel fuel.

A fire broke out on the 100 foot fishing vessel Arctic Dawn while moored at the Lake Washington Ship Canal, Seattle, Washington. The fire was contained by local firefighters but the vessel sustained severe damage to the superstructure.
The Arctic Dawn has appeared in the Discover Channel’s show “Deadliest Catch”.
